Aero: Designed and Released by Dell
The Dell Aero is a smartphone that was designed and released by the popular computer brand, Dell. It was first announced in March 2010 and was finally released in August that year. Packed with Features to Impress
The Dell Aero may have been released over a decade ago, but it still boasts some impressive features. For starters, it runs on the Android 1.5 operating system, also known as Cupcake. The device weighs only 104g and has a thickness of 11.7mm, making it lightweight and easy to carry around.
Display and Dimensions
The Aero comes with a 122 x 57.9 x 11.7 mm body, making it the perfect size to fit comfortably in your hand. It has a 3.5-inch TFT display with 256K colors, providing clear and vibrant visuals. With a resolution of 360 x 640 pixels and a 16:9 aspect ratio, the Aero offers a decent viewing experience.
One of the most impressive features of the Aero is its Corning Gorilla Glass protection, ensuring that your device remains scratch-free and durable. Additionally, it also comes with handwriting recognition, making it easier to take notes or jot down reminders on the go.
Powerful Performance for Everyday Use
The Dell Aero is powered by a Marvell PXA310 624 MHz CPU, providing efficient and smooth performance. It also has a microSDHC card slot for additional storage, making it easier to store all your important photos, videos, and documents.
Camera and Sound
The Aero comes with a 5-megapixel single camera with autofocus and LED flash, making it a good choice for capturing everyday moments. It also has video recording capabilities at CIF@30fps. However, the device does not come with a front-facing camera for selfies.
When it comes to sound, the Aero includes a loudspeaker and supports Wi-Fi 802.11 b/g and Bluetooth 2.0 with A2DP technology. It also has GPS and A-GPS for easy navigation and a miniUSB 2.0 port for charging and data transfer.
All the Essentials in One Package
Apart from its impressive display and performance, the Dell Aero offers many other features that make it a great choice. It has sensors like an accelerometer and proximity sensor, along with HTML and Adobe Flash Lite support for browsing the internet. The device also includes a photo viewer/editor, organizer, voice memo, and predictive text input – essential for everyday use.
Long-lasting Battery and Affordable Price
Battery life is always a major concern when choosing a smartphone, and the Dell Aero falls short in that department. It comes with a removable Li-Ion 1000 mAh battery that offers up to 400 hours of standby time and up to 5 hours of talk time.
